The Truck Driver will deliver customer orders or pick up merchandise by operating the company vehicles in a safe and expeditious manner. Actively contributes to a positive and productive working environment.

Shift Details: 40 hours/week (4‑day schedule at 10 hours per day); open availability required. Schedule includes 3 days off per week (two consecutive days off and one separate off day)

Here’s Where You’ll Have An Impact
  • Pre-inspect truck
  • Complete manifest/ log book
  • Ensure that the proper documentation is maintained
  • Maintain equipment and report any damages, necessary repairs, or malfunctions
  • Drive transport truck or straight truck in a safe and respectful manner
  • Ensure merchandise loaded in vehicle is stowed in a safe and damage-free manner
  • Unload trailer at stores
  • Ensure case-count delivered corresponds with order, pick up credit, or damaged product
  • Maintain good working relations with customers at all times through cooperative attitude and well-groomed appearance
  • Exercise good driving manners and taking precautionary measures during inclement weather conditions
  • Follow the instructions outlined in the driver SOP and pay attention to detail
  • Maintain a clean and safe work environment as per company requirements
  • Responsible for all other duties assigned by manager
What You Bring To The Table
  • Accuracy and attention to detail to ensure the case-count delivered corresponds with the order
  • A proven track record of superior customer service skills
  • Two to three years experience driving a tractor-trailer and/ or straight truck
  • High School Graduate
  • Class 5 Drivers License
  • Retail support centre
  • Hand bombing required for loading and unloading
  • Physical work including frequent bending, lifting, and reaching
  • Two person lift required for weights exceeding 50 lbs
  • Ability to stand and walk for long periods of time
  • Possible exposure to extreme temperatures
  • Alertness to other people and vehicles
  • Various shifts including evenings and weekends
